Montreal: an octogenarian hit by a vehicle in Ahuntsic

An 82-year-old pedestrian was struck by a vehicle very late Wednesday in the Ahuntsic-Cartierville borough, in Montreal.

The City of Montreal Police Department was alerted shortly before 11:30 p.m. by 911 calls about a collision between a vehicle and a pedestrian near Papineau Avenue and Sauriol Street.

When the police arrived on site, they located the pedestrian injured in the upper body, said SPVM spokesperson Caroline Chèvrefils.

The victim was transported to a hospital, but there is no danger to his life, despite the significant injuries, according to Montreal police.

The 30-year-old driver who was traveling westbound on Sauriol Street began a left turn before hitting the octogenarian who was crossing Papineau Avenue eastbound.

Police officers specializing in collision investigation were dispatched to the scene to analyze the scene and try to shed light on this accident, while witnesses to the event were met.
